JUSTICE BIRENDRA KUMAR ORAL ORDER 26-10-2018 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ned Additional Public Prosecutor for the State. The petitioner is apprehending his arrest in a case registered for the offences punishable under Section 409,419,420,467,468 of the Indian Penal Code. Allegation against the petitioner is that he used forged certificate of his date of birth for getting benefit of extended service.
Submission is that none of the certificates are forged one rather the allegation is yet to be established. Petitioner is a reputed Doctor. He has got no criminal antecedent.
Considering the aforesaid factual position, let

No.57051 of 2018 (3) dt.26-10-2018 2/2 the petitioner, above named, in the event of his arrest or surrender before the court below within a period of thirty days from the date of receipt of the order, be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s.20,000 (Twenty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ned court below where the case is pending in connection with Begusarai Town P.S.Case No.366 of 2017, subject to the conditions as laid down under Section 438(2) of the Code of Criminal Procedure and further the petitioner shall fully cooperate with the investigation/trial of the case, failing which the court below shall be at liberty to cancel the bail bond of the petitioner.
